On 07/22/2018 10:49 PM, David Miller wrote:
> I don't have access to any of my sparc64 systems at the moment, but I
> suspect that what might be happening is that the register window state
> gets such that the kernel window trap handlers cannot resolve it and
> we get stuck in the kernel looping either over the window fixup handler
> or the fault resolving paths.
